一、在Python中,基本数据类型主要可分为以下几种:

数字(Number);

字符串(String);

列表(List);

字典(Dictionary);

元组(Tuple);

1.在Python3中,支持的数字类型有:

int–整型

float–浮点型

bool–布尔型

fractions–分数

complex–复数

声明:

左边是变量名,右边是要赋的值,不需要在前面指定数据类型,并且Python能通过赋的值自动区分出来是整型还是浮点型;

注意:基本运算有:+、-、、/运算外,还有三种运算:整除运算"//",乘方运算"**",取余运算"%"

(1)除法表示

python中的除数表示,结果为浮点型。

整除运算结果。

(2)复数表示

python中的复数表示,需导入cmoplex库。

(3)分数表示

python中的分数需要导入fraction库,然后调用库中的Fraction()方法

变量可一次性申请多个:

小贴士:

1.在Python中对大小写敏感,例如d=true将会报错;

2.可以使用type()函数来检测值或者变量的类型;

3.可以使用isinstance()函数来判断某个值或者变量是否为指定的数据类型;

例如:

4.在Python3中,整型可以非常大;

5.Python可以检测分母为0的情况,如果分母为0,编译时将报错;

6.在Python中进行基本的三角函数运算,但要事先引入标准库 math:

特别注意:

同大多数编程语言一样,可以将float强制转换为int,如:a = int(2.5),但要注意的是,结果a的值是2,并非四舍五入成为3;

float的精度为小数点后面15位;

执行 / 运算时,即便分子分母都是int类型,且能被整除,返回的值也是float类型;

写出python中6种数据类型_Python数据类型(一)相关推荐

  1. 写出python中的六种数据类型_python 数据类型1

    一.字典 一组键(key)和值(value)的组合,通过键(key)进行查找,没有顺序, 使用大括号"{}"; 1.1 现有字典 d={'a':24,'g':52,'i':12,' ...

  2. python中5种简单的数据类型,Python小白零基础入门 —— 变量及简单的数据类型

    微信公众号:「Python读财」 若有问题或建议,请公众号留言 最近想着出一个Python小白零基础入门系列的文章,但愿能对入门的小伙伴有所帮助,内容会囊括简单的数据类型.列表.字典.循环以及函数的定 ...

  3. python中5种简单的数据类型,没有学不会的python--认识简单的数据类型

    没有学不会的python 先提一下肛 相信很多同学都听过数据类型这个词吧?无论是零基础还是有其他编程语言的同学,对这个词都不会陌生.基本上来说,无论什么教程,都是会把这个数据类型提前拿出来讲透,因为这 ...

  4. python 中五种常用的数据类型

    一.字符串 单引号定义: str1 = 'hello' 双引号定义: str1 = "hello" 三引号定义:"""人生苦短,我用python!&q ...

  5. python中res代表什么_Python数据类型的用法

    字符串的用法 res ='hellow,world'print(res) #res.显示的都是它的方法,下划线的除外 1 判断字符串的结尾字符,返回的值的布尔形式 endswith 判断字符串的开头字 ...

  6. 写出python字符串三种常用的函数或方法_python中几种常用字符串函数

    1.lower()把所有字符换成小写 2.upper()把所有字符换成大写 3.swapcase()大小写互换 4.title()把每个单词首字母大写,他是以所有英文字母的字符来区别是否为一个单词的, ...

  7. python中系列的含义_python中四种组合数据类型的含义、声明、增删改查,遍历

    一.列表 列表:list 可以存储多个有顺序的可以重复的数据的类型 其他语言:数据:python中~提供的是列表[不说数组] 列表:操作数据:增加.删除.修改.查询 [CRUD] append/ins ...

  8. python中包含的标准数据类型_Python数据类型基础

    1. Python标准数据类型 Python3 中有六个 标准的数据类型: Number(数字) String(字符串) List(列表) Tuple(元组) Set(集合) Dictionary(字 ...

  9. python中4j什么意思_Python学习:4.数据类型以及运算符详解

    运算符 一.算数运算: 二.比较运算: 三.赋值运算 四.逻辑运算 五.成员运算 基本数据类型 一.Number(数字) Python3中支持int.float.bool.complex. 使用内置的 ...

最新文章

  1. 排序 时间倒序_经典排序算法之冒泡排序(Bubble Sort)
  2. HashMap和Hashtable的区别总结
  3. java hashcode返回值_Java String hashCode() 使用方法及示例
  4. mysql distinct、group_concat
  5. E820-DTU与昆仑通态组态软件联机
  6. JAVA基础----java中E,T,?的区别
  7. Ubuntu 20.04 LTS 代号 “Focal Fossa“,明年 4 月正式发布
  8. 判断一个对象是否存在
  9. 将2^n (n=1000000) 转化为10进制输出
  10. Alfa: 1 vulnhub walkthrough
  11. HTML(二)在网页中插入表格
  12. 低代码平台有哪些?值得推荐的低代码公司?
  13. 揭露安利!!!!!!
  14. [node]nvs使用的注意事项
  15. 区块链技术在三角债清收领域的应用思考
  16. 【机器人学、机器视觉与控制】用工具箱确定D-H参数
  17. Chrome 的哪些功能改变了我们浏览网页的方式?
  18. python培训班报名
  19. 电能质量分析仪的功能和工作原理
  20. 郭明錤:苹果最早从今年第四季度开始大规模生产AR设备

热门文章

  1. 手机android7能升9吗,安卓9.0得到用户一致好评,这六款手机已升级!你还在用安卓7.0?...
  2. Ubuntu 777权限的文件夹绿底蓝字更改
  3. Linux挖坑脚本,Windows环境下写Linux sh脚本的一次挖坑和填坑
  4. ji32k7au4a83
  5. Vuex的用法及组成部分
  6. 人工智能项目取得成功,主要有哪几种方法?
  7. android 查看gpio状态_iTOP-iMX6开发板-GPIO读写配置文档_V1.0《2》
  8. SAS初级编程系列视频:第三章编辑和调试SAS程序
  9. idea搭建spark开发环境完整版(windows)
  10. 龙芯板卡内存压力测试方法